Faith at St. Benedict

“Let them put Christ before all else; and may He lead us all to everlasting life.”
— Rule of Saint Benedict

At St. Benedict, our Catholic faith is at the heart of everything we do. Each day begins and ends with prayer, includes daily Religion class, and is rooted in Scripture, the lives of the Saints, and the teachings of the Church. Our week is crowned by the celebration of Holy Mass, the source and summit of our Catholic life.

We seek to form a strong Catholic identity in our students by grounding all instruction in the magisterial teachings and traditions of the Church. Faith is not an added subject, but the very atmosphere in which our school lives and breathes.

Our goal is to create a true Catholic culture—one in which classrooms, hallways, and activities reflect the presence of Christ. Students are surrounded by signs of our faith—religious images, statues, and prayer opportunities—that lift their minds and hearts to God.

We teach that the human condition can only be fully understood through the lens of the Fall of Man and the saving work of Jesus Christ. In this way, we help students grow in wisdom and holiness, preparing them not just for academic success, but for eternal life with Him.
